Teamglobal, a staffing services firm with a reported revenue of $6.3 million, was listed by the ransomware group morpheus on November 17, 2025. The listing states that internal files were exfiltrated during a ransomware attack. No figure for the number of individuals affected has been released, and the company’s site teamglobal.com is referenced in the report.

Breaking down the breach

The only confirmed detail is the group’s public listing of Teamglobal. The entry describes exfiltration of internal files but provides no information on the volume of data, the date of the intrusion, or whether encryption occurred. Public records do not yet contain an official statement from Teamglobal confirming or disputing the claim.

Who is morpheus?

Morpheus is a ransomware operation that maintains a leak site to publish names of organizations from which it claims to have obtained data. Such groups commonly combine file encryption with data theft to pressure victims. The listing of Teamglobal constitutes the group’s assertion; independent verification of the claimed files has not been published.

Who is Teamglobal?

Teamglobal provides contract and direct-hire staffing services, primarily in aerospace and light industrial sectors, and states thirty years of operation. Organizations of this type routinely collect and store records on job applicants, current and former employees, client companies, and internal business operations. A compromise at such a firm can therefore touch both personal employment data and commercial information.

What was likely exposed

The listing refers only to “internal files.” The precise categories of data remain undisclosed. Staffing firms commonly hold resumes, contact details, employment histories, payroll information, and client contracts, yet none of these categories have been confirmed in this case.

What's at stake

Individuals whose records appear in the exfiltrated files face the possibility that their personal or employment information could be used for targeted fraud or sold. For the organization, the incident may affect client relationships and require investigation and remediation costs whose scale is not yet public.
